Job Purpose:
Develop, review and analyse the tactical aspect of the business application system.
Responsibilities:
Responsible for the implementation and maintenance of the group’s enterprise applications and its platform.
Develop and maintain strong working relationship with end user/process owners to understand requirements and deliver/promote technical solutions as appropriate.
The individual must be able to provide technical expertise and have system administration experience. This individual will apply proven communication, analytical, and problem-solving skills to help maximize the benefit of enterprise IT system investments.
Essential Function:
· Day to day operational user support and improvement of existing systems and processes to support the business
· Oversee development of business process requirements, includes working with application vendors and partners to define project scope and deliverables that support business objectives
· Improve design, configure and implement data integration between multiple enterprise systems along with future strategy towards enterprise integration platform.
· Investigate, recommend and implement new technology to enhance capability and financial reporting
· SQL Database Administrator, Designs/Maintain BI Reports (Tableau/Power BI)
· Develop and manage the Microsoft 365 SharePoint Site, Applications and Website.
· Undertake any other IT activities as required
Skills Requirements / Qualification:
· Diploma / Degree in Computer Science or equivalent with at least 5 years of working experience, preferably in the application development environment.
· Comprehensive knowledge of object-oriented development environments
General knowledge of development languages/platforms including C++/C#, VB.Net, ASP, ASP.Net, COM/COM+, XML, IIS, HTML, DHTML, ODBC, SOAP, ADO, ADO.NET, Java Script, Crystal Reports, & SQL Server
· Strong relational database knowledge (SQL Server preferred including SSIS, SSRS, SSAS) and IBM DB2.
· Familiarity with visualization and reporting tools (examples include Power BI, Tableau, Qlikview)
· Proficient in use of Microsoft Development Tools and Methods
· Strong team player with effective communication skills and working relationships with peers, co-workers, and senior management
· Ability to lead, coach and work in a fast paced, time-sensitive and complex environment
· Ability to think strategically and tactically to reach sound decisions
· Process-oriented; Attentive to details and anticipating project management challenges.
· Interested candidates, please submit a detailed resume and expected salary.